Исключить целевую папку из результатов поиска в Eclipse - PullRequest
61 голосов
/ 21 ноября 2011

Мне было интересно, возможно ли исключить целевую папку из быстрый поиск затмения :

Ctrl + Shift + R

Если кто-нибудь знает, как это сделать, пожалуйста, сообщите.

Обновление: я использую Maven 2 и M2E , WTP Eclipse plug-in.

Ответы [ 3 ]

102 голосов
/ 21 ноября 2011
  1. Пометьте "целевые" папки как "производные" ресурсы на экране свойств этих папок (эта опция находится рядом только для чтения и свойства архива).

  2. На экране быстрого поиска ( Ctrl + Shift + R ) нажмите стрелку в правом верхнем углуи снимите флажок «Показать производные ресурсы».

Тогда эти целевые файлы больше не будут учитываться при быстром поиске.

28 голосов
/ 30 июня 2015

Перейдите в Проект> Свойства> Ресурс> Фильтры ресурсов

Нажмите Добавить фильтр ...

Тип фильтра:

  • Исключить все

Применяется к:

  • Папкам
  • Проверить все дочерние элементы (рекурсивные)

Подробности фильтра:

  • Имя
  • Совпадения
  • Введите в текстовое поле: target
0 голосов
/ 27 марта 2018

Вы можете установить Плагин AutoDeriv из Eclipse Marketplace или http://nodj.github.io/AutoDeriv/.. Позволяет создавать либо глобальные (рабочее пространство), либо отдельные проекты .derived файлы, в которых вы можете указать, какие файлыпапки должны быть помечены как производные.

Вот пример файла конфигурации (взят с домашней страницы плагина):

# set the 'target' and 'ext' folders as derived
target
ext
# but don't affect the 'keep' sub-folder
!target/keep
# all files with a '.dep' extension are generated
*.dep
src/include/version.h # this specific file is also generated.
...